Chechen SC refuses to change judge in Oyub Titiev's case

Today, the defence of Oyub Titiev, the head of the Human Rights Centre (HRC) "Memorial" in Grozny, has unsuccessfully requested to challenge the judge considering the transfer of the rights defender's case to another region.

Since January 11, 2018, Oyub Titiev is under arrest on charges of possessing marijuana. The rights defender asserts that the drugs were planted on him by a law enforcer.

The "Caucasian Knot" has reported that today, the Supreme Court (SC) of Chechnya has begun consideration of the motion filed by the Oyub Titiev's defence to change the territorial jurisdiction of his case. Oyub Titiev himself participates in the trial through video communication, and he supported the motion filed by his advocates.

At trial, advocate Pyotr Zaikin requested the court to investigate the media reports with statements about the Oyub Titiev's guilt and asked to invite an interpreter from the Chechen language for that purpose. Oyub Titiev himself and his second advocate Dubrovina supported Pyotr Zaikin, while public prosecutor opposed the motion.

The judge dismissed the motion and explained his decision by the fact that there is a huge array of information about Oyub Titiev on the Internet. Pyotr Zaikin responded that he insisted on the investigation into the specific material and that he treated the refusal as a violation. The advocate challenged the judge.

Advocate Dubrovina and Oyub Titiev supported the motion to challenge the judge, while the public prosecutor called it groundless. After a short break, the judge refused to grant the motion for challenge, the HRC "Memorial" reports today in its Telegram channel.

The illustration was created by the Caucasian Knot using AI The peace agreement between Armenia and Azerbaijan, as well as other documents signed at the meeting with Trump on August 8, 2025

The “Caucasian Knot" publishes the agreement on the establishment of peace and interstate relations between Azerbaijan and Armenia, which was initialed by Armenian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an and Azerbaijani President Ilham Aliyev on August 8, 2025, through the mediation of US President Donald Trump. The meeting of Trump, Aliyev and Pashinyan took place on August 8 in Washington. Following the meeting, Pashinyan and Aliyev also signed a joint declaration. In addition to the agreements between Armenia and Azerbaijan, Trump signed a number of separate memoranda with Aliyev and Pashinyan....

Zelimkhan Khangoshvili. Photo courtesy of press service of HRC 'Memorial', http://memohrc.org/ Zelimkhan Khangoshvili

A participant of the second Chechen military campaign, one of the field commanders close to Shamil Basaev and Aslan Maskhadov. Shot dead in Berlin in 2019.

Magomed Daudov. Photo: screenshot of the video http://video.agaclip.com/w=atDtPvLYH9o Magomed Daudov

Magomed "Lord" Daudov is a former Chechen militant who was awarded the title of "Hero of Russia", the chairman of the Chechen parliament under Ramzan Kadyrov.

Tumso Abdurakhmanov. Screenshot from video posted by Abu-Saddam Shishani [LIVE] http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=mIR3s7AB0Uw Tumso Abdurakhmanov

Tumso Abdurakhmanov is a blogger from Chechnya. After a conflict with Ramzan Kadyrov's relative, he left the republic and went first to Georgia, and then to Poland, where he is trying to get political asylum.
